Unitary representations of unitary groups

Abstract: In this paper we review and streamline some results of Kirillov, Olshanski and Pickrell on unitary representations of the unitary group U(cH) of a real, complex or quaternionic separable Hilbert space and the subgroup Uinfty(cH), consisting of those unitary operators g for which g1 is compact. The Kirillov--Olshanski theorem on the continuous unitary representations of the identity component Uinfty(cH)0 asserts that they are direct sums of irreducible ones which can be realized in finite tensor products of a suitable complex Hilbert space. This is proved and generalized to inseparable spaces. These results are carried over to the full unitary group by Pickrell's Theorem, asserting that the separable unitary representations of U(cH), for a separable Hilbert space cH, are uniquely determined by their restriction to Uinfty(cH)0. For the 10 classical infinite rank symmetric pairs (G,K) of non-unitary type, such as (GL(cH),U(cH)), we also show that all separable unitary representations are trivial.
